The Flu: A Common Ailment That Requires Effective Remedies

Flu, short for influenza, is a highly contagious viral infection that affects millions of people worldwide. The symptoms can range from mild to severe, including fever, cough, sore throat, body aches, and fatigue. While there is no cure for the flu, there are several remedies that can help alleviate the symptoms and promote a faster recovery.

The Power of Rest and Hydration

One of the most crucial aspects of recovering from the flu is getting plenty of rest and staying hydrated. Rest allows your body to conserve energy and focus on fighting off the infection, while hydration helps flush out toxins and keeps your respiratory system functioning properly. Make sure to drink plenty of fluids, including water, herbal teas, and warm broths.

Hot Showers and Steam Inhalation

A hot shower can do wonders for relieving congestion and soothing a sore throat. The steam helps to loosen mucus and clears your nasal passages, providing temporary relief. You can also try steam inhalation by filling a bowl with hot water, placing a towel over your head, and inhaling the steam for a few minutes. Adding essential oils like eucalyptus or peppermint can enhance the healing effects.

Natural Remedies: Honey and Ginger

Honey and ginger have long been used as natural remedies for various ailments, including the flu. Honey has antimicrobial properties that can help soothe a sore throat, while ginger has anti-inflammatory properties that can reduce inflammation and ease nausea. You can mix honey and ginger in warm water or tea for a comforting and healing beverage.

Soothing Herbal Teas

Herbal teas, such as chamomile, peppermint, and echinacea, can provide relief for flu symptoms. Chamomile has calming properties that can help with sleep and relaxation, while peppermint can soothe a sore throat and relieve nausea. Echinacea is known for its immune-boosting abilities and can help your body fight off the virus more effectively.

Over-the-Counter Medications

If your symptoms are severe or persistent, over-the-counter medications can provide temporary relief. Pain relievers like acetaminophen or ibuprofen can help reduce fever, body aches, and headaches. However, it’s essential to follow the recommended dosage and consult a healthcare professional if your symptoms worsen or persist.

When to Seek Medical Attention

In most cases, the flu can be managed at home with the remedies mentioned above. However, certain situations warrant medical attention. If your symptoms worsen or persist for more than a week, if you experience difficulty breathing, chest pain, or severe dehydration, it’s crucial to seek medical assistance immediately.
